Southeast QLD Severe Thunderstorm Warning: Flash Flooding, Damaging Winds
Source: Bureau of Meteorology

For people in parts of the BRISBANE CITY, MORETON BAY, IPSWICH CITY, SUNSHINE COAST and SOMERSET Council Areas.

Issued at 2:32 pm Thursday, 1 December 2011.

The Bureau of Meteorology warns that, at 2:25 pm, severe thunderstorms were detected on weather radar near Ipswich, Wamuran, Beerburrum, Woodford and Mount Mee. These thunderstorms are slow moving. They are forecast to affect Caboolture, Redbank Plains, Lake Manchester and Mount Beerwah by 2:55 pm and Fernvale, northern Bribie Island, Beerwah and Peachester by 3:25 pm.

Damaging winds, very heavy rainfall and flash flooding are likely.

50mm of rain has been recorded near Ipswich in the last hour.

Emergency Management Queensland advises that people should:
* Move your car under cover or away from trees.
* Secure loose outdoor items.
* Avoid driving, walking or riding through flood waters.
* Seek shelter, preferably indoors and never under trees.
* Avoid using the telephone during a thunderstorm.
* Beware of fallen trees and powerlines.
* For emergency assistance contact the SES on 132 500.
